Advanced Oxidation Protein Products Promote Lipotoxicity and Tubulointerstitial Fibrosis via CD36/β-Catenin Pathway in Diabetic Nephropathy.
Xiao Li,Ting Zhang,Jian Geng,Zhuguo Wu,Liting Xu,Jixing Liu,Jianwei Tian,Zhanmei Zhou,Jing Nie,Xiaoyan Bai +9 more
TL;DR: A major role of AOPPs is revealed in triggering lipotoxicity and fibrosis via CD36-dependent Wnt/β-catenin activation, providing new evidences for understanding the role of lipid accumulation in DN.

Hyperhomocysteinemia Accelerates Acute Kidney Injury to Chronic Kidney Disease Progression by Downregulating Heme Oxygenase-1 Expression.
Shuang Li,Bingbing Qiu,Hong Lu,Yunshi Lai,Jixing Liu,Jiajun Luo,Fengxin Zhu,Zheng Hu,Miaomiao Zhou,Jianwei Tian,Zhanmei Zhou,Shouyi Yu,Fan Yi,Jing Nie +13 more
TL;DR: Investigation of whether hyperhomocysteinemia (Hhcy) accelerates the development of renal fibrosis after AKI indicated that Hhcy might be a novel risk factor that promotes AKI to CKD progression, and lowering Hcy level or HO-1 inductionmight be a potential therapeutic strategy to improve the outcome of AKI.

Identification of matrix metalloproteinase-10 as a key mediator of podocyte injury and proteinuria.
Yangyang Zuo,Cong Wang,Xiaoli Sun,Chengxiao Hu,Jixing Liu,Xue Hong,Weiwei Shen,Jing Nie,Fan Fan Hou,Lili Zhou,Youhua Liu,Youhua Liu +11 more
TL;DR: In this paper, gene expression profiling in the glomeruli by RNA sequencing was used to discover matrix metalloproteinase-10 (MMP-10), a secreted zinc-dependent endopeptidase, as one of the most upregulated genes after glomerular injury.
